## JSON取值 Java多层级 ### 什么是JSONJS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于阅读和编写,也易于解析和生成。JSON是基于JavaScript的一个子集,但可以被多种编程语言解析和生成。 JSON由键值对组成,其中键是字符串,值可以是字符串、数字、布尔值、数组、对象或null。JSON的结构可以嵌套,形成多层级
原创 7月前
127阅读
json转成树状结构,然后展开成list,有key就取key,没key就取value,通过递归实现JSONNode 是节点类,其中的key就是json的key,value是如果没有子节点的json的value建这俩类唯一的好处就是把jsonobject格式化成一个确定的类,方便递归,就不用每次获取value的时候多次遍历看下面有多少个子节点,关键不知道层数,不方便递归children是
转载 2023-06-11 18:54:01
177阅读
使用到的类:net.sf.json.JSONObject使用JSON时,除了要导入JSON网站上面下载的json-lib-2.2-jdk15.jar包之外,还必须有其它几个依赖包:commons-beanutils.jar,commons-httpclient.jar,commons-lang.jar,ezmorph.jar,morph-1.0.1.jar下面是例子代码:// JSON转换 JSO
# Java多层级复杂JSON解析 ## 简介 在Java开发中,我们经常会遇到需要解析复杂的JSON数据的情况。本文将指导刚入行的开发者如何使用Java进行多层级复杂JSON解析。 ## 流程 下表展示了解析多层级复杂JSON的步骤: | 步骤 | 描述 | | --- | --- | | 步骤1 | 导入相关的JSON库 | | 步骤2 | 读取JSON数据 | | 步骤3 | 解析JS
原创 10月前
773阅读
# 如何实现MySQL查询json多层级对象 ## 1. 流程 | 步骤 | 描述 | | --- | --- | | 1 | 创建一个包含json数据的表 | | 2 | 查询json数据 | | 3 | 解析json数据 | ```mermaid gantt title MySQL查询json多层级对象流程 section 创建表 创建表: 1, 1, 1
原创 4月前
57阅读
### 多层级JSON转对象 Java 在实际开发中,我们经常会遇到需要将多层级JSON数据转换成Java对象的情况。这种情况下,我们需要使用Java中的一些工具来帮助我们将JSON数据转换成对象,并且处理多层级的数据结构。在本文中,我们将介绍如何使用一些常用的工具来实现这个功能。 #### JSON数据示例 首先,让我们来看一个简单的多层级JSON数据示例: ```json { "
原创 6月前
46阅读
## Shell脚本解析JSON多层级 ### 一、流程概述 首先,我们需要明确整个流程的步骤。下面是整个流程的概要: | 步骤 | 描述 | |----|---| | 1 | 读取JSON文件内容 | | 2 | 使用jq工具解析JSON数据 | | 3 | 遍历并提取多层级数据 | ### 二、详细步骤及代码示例 #### 步骤一:读取JSON文件内容 ```shell json_f
原创 3月前
177阅读
# Java Map 接收多层级 JSON 在 Java 开发中,处理 JSON 数据是一项常见的任务。JSON(JavaScript Object Notation)是一种常用的数据交换格式,其结构简单清晰,易于阅读和编写。在实际开发中,我们经常会遇到需要将多层级JSON 数据解析成 Java 对象的情况。 Java 提供了多种处理 JSON 数据的库,如 Jackson、Gson 等。
原创 10月前
84阅读
# Java JSON多层级 Map 的详细解析 在现代软件开发中,JSON(JavaScript Object Notation)作为一种轻量级的数据交换格式,广泛应用于不同编程语言之间的数据传输。然而,当我们在 Java 中处理 JSON 数据时,常常需要将其转换为更易操作的数据结构,特别是 `Map`。 ## JSON 和 Map 的关系 在 Java 中,JSON 数据通常以嵌套
原创 15天前
23阅读
FastJson、Jackson处理Json转换对象、复杂对象问题 在开发过程中最常见的就是Json格式转化问题。包括Json转对象,转数据,转Map等等。常见处理json的类库FastJson,Jackson为此我针对他们做了一些总结,如有欠缺可以留言。希望可以帮助大家。FastJson准备两个套娃的类@Data @AllArgsConstructor @NoArgsConstructor pu
# 使用Java递归修改JSON多层级值的实现指南 在这篇文章中,我们将探讨如何使用Java递归来修改JSON多层级值。J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,广泛应用于Web应用与API中。掌握如何操作JSON数据结构是每位开发者的重要技能。 ## 流程概述 下面是实现的主要步骤: | 步骤 | 描述
原创 7天前
10阅读
## 使用Python递归修改多层级JSON的数据 在处理复杂的多层级JSON(JavaScript Object Notation)数据时,需要明白如何进行遍历和修改。尤其是当你希望保持原始结构不变时,递归是一种非常有效的技术。本文将给你展示如何实现这一点。 ### 整体流程 以下是实现的整体步骤: | 步骤 | 描述 | | ---- | ---- | | 1 | 导入所需的库
原创 10天前
7阅读
java中json数据生成和解析(复杂对象演示) 1.json简单介绍  1.1 json是最流行和广泛通用的数据传输格式,简称JavaScript Object Notation,最早在JavaScript中使用.  1.2 举个例子,下面是一个json对象,名字叫王尼玛,他有两个粉丝组成数组,一个叫小王,一个叫小尼玛:   {       "name":"王尼玛",       "
转载 2023-07-20 10:15:56
149阅读
  这一篇涉及到如何在网页请求环节使用多进程任务处理功能,因为网页请求涉及到两个重要问题:一是多进程的并发操作会面临更大的反爬风险,所以面临更严峻的反爬风险,二是抓取网页数据需要获取返回值,而且这些返回值需要汇集成一个关系表(数据框)(区别于上一篇中的二进制文件下载,文件下载仅仅执行语句块命令即可,无需收集返回值)。R语言使用RCurl+XML,Python使用urllib+l
# Java中获取多层级JSON数据的实现 ## 引言 本文将介绍如何在Java中获取多层级JSON数据。首先,我们将通过一个流程图展示整个过程,然后逐步讲解每一步需要做什么,并给出相应的代码示例。 ## 流程图 ```mermaid flowchart TD Start(开始) ParseJson(解析JSON) GetNestedData(获取多层级数据) E
原创 9月前
156阅读
这两天周末加班把复杂的多层级的标签功能实现了一下,算是遇到的最难的一个功能了,前台jsp页面利用jquery拼接数组,后台转换成json,然后再转java对象,主要是多层级的。看一下前端页面图1.首先理解一下这个标签的层级关系 总类目–>二级类目–>一级标签–>二级标签; 总共是四层目录级别。前台进行遍历展现是很容易的,但是在添加的时候是非常的苦难的。2.js代码:在jquer
转载 8月前
24阅读
# Python中处理JSON字符串的多层级数据 J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于人阅读和编写,同时也易于机器解析和生成。在Python中,我们可以使用`json`模块来处理JSON数据。然而,当JSON数据结构变得复杂,包含多层级时,如何有效地获取数据就成为了一个挑战。 ## JSON数据结构 首先,让我们了解一下JSON的基
原创 1月前
20阅读
# 多层级 JSON 字符串转 JSON 对象 Java 在 Java 编程中,我们经常需要处理 JSON 数据,将其转换成 Java 对象以便于操作。有时候,我们会遇到多层级JSON 字符串,需要将其转换成多层级JSON 对象。本文将介绍如何在 Java 中实现这一功能,并提供代码示例。 ## JSON 数据简介 JSON(JavaScript Object Notation)是一
原创 5月前
207阅读
首先介绍这两种算法之前,先介绍一个mysql关联表优化的原则,即小表驱动大表(这个后续会解释) 1.Nested-Loop Join(NLJ):    我现在先创建两张表,emp_a里面有5条数据,emp_b里面有40条数据(数据生成太麻烦了,有兴趣的可以生成多一点的数据去试验一下),name字段设索引,age字段不设索引对这两张表做关联查询查看执行计划 &
很多时候我们见到的json数据都是多层嵌套的,就像下面这般:{"name":"桔子桑", "sex":"男", "age":18, "grade":{"gname":"三年八班", "gdesc":"初三年级八班" } }要获得以上类型json数据,不外乎以下步骤:1.数据库查询sql:select s.name,s.sex,s.age,g.gnam
  • 1
  • 2
  • 3
  • 4
  • 5